Output 5ae128ce109389efed517e50a48c31b6886113496aee6469c7be238945475d69:19

value
123423
script pubkey
OP_0 OP_PUSHBYTES_20 30837792ae39613145fe6d35fe6ba20c9e4161e6
address
bc1qxzph0y4w89snz307d56lu6azpj0yzc0xzvynfd
transaction
5ae128ce109389efed517e50a48c31b6886113496aee6469c7be238945475d69
spent
true